| dc.description | The analysis of observed conditional distributions of both lagged and simultaneous intraday price increments of a basket of stocks reveals phenomena of dependence - induced volatility smile and kurtosis reduction. A model based on multivariate t-Student distribution shows that the observed effects are caused by colelctive non-gaussian dependence properties of financial time series. | |
